Abhay Gupta, Philip Meng, and Ece Yurtseven selected as 1 of 20 spotlight projects out of 335 submissions at NeurIPS High School Track 2024.

Three Algoverse students—Abhay Gupta, Philip Meng, and Ece Yurtseven—have earned acceptance to the NeurIPS High School Track 2024. They were selected as 1 of 20 spotlight projects out of 335 total submissions, an approximately 5% acceptance rate.

Their research project, titled "AAVENUE: Detecting LLM Biases on NLU Tasks in AAVE via a Novel Benchmark," develops evaluation methods for language model biases with specific focus on African American Vernacular English. The work addresses fairness concerns in artificial intelligence systems.

The students previously received acceptance to NLP4PI at EMNLP earlier in September. This dual acceptance to two major international conferences represents an extraordinary achievement for undergraduate and high school students.
